Common Uses of ISA Slot Motherboards

Industrial Automation: ISA-based systems are commonly found in industrial automation applications, where stability and compatibility are critical. These systems control machinery, monitor sensors, and perform data logging.

Legacy System Integration: Many legacy systems rely on ISA cards for essential functionality. By using ISA slot motherboards, these systems can be maintained and upgraded without the need for costly hardware replacements.

Scientific Research: Scientific research often involves the use of specialized data acquisition cards. ISA slot motherboards provide a reliable and cost-effective platform for integrating these cards into research systems.

Key Features of ISA Slot Motherboards

  • Standard ISA Slots: ISA slot motherboards provide multiple ISA expansion slots, typically ranging from two to eight, allowing for the installation of various legacy cards.
  • PCI and PCIe Support: Some modern ISA slot motherboards also include PCI and PCIe slots, enabling the integration of newer peripheral devices.
  • Onboard Features: To enhance functionality, some ISA slot motherboards feature integrated components such as Ethernet controllers, audio codecs, and USB ports.

Effective Strategies

  • Choose a Motherboard with Ample Slots: Determine the number of ISA cards required for your application and select a motherboard with an appropriate number of slots.
  • Verify Card Compatibility: Check the documentation for both the motherboard and the ISA cards to ensure compatibility.
  • Install the Cards Securely: Gently insert the ISA cards into the slots and secure them using the provided screws or latches.
  • Configure the BIOS: Configure the motherboard's BIOS to enable the ISA slots and allocate any necessary resources to the installed cards.

Advanced Features

  • ISA Bridge Chipsets: Some ISA slot motherboards utilize bridge chipsets to connect to the system bus, providing enhanced compatibility and performance.
  • Plug-and-Play Support: Plug-and-Play (PnP) capable ISA slot motherboards simplify card configuration by auto-detecting and assigning resources to installed devices.
  • Removable Headers: Removable headers allow for easy access to ISA signals for debugging and hardware modifications.
